Seems related to my usecase in dotnet C# application calls made to libgdiplus to render specific fonts failing in 6.1
Dropping back to jammy version 6.0.4 of libgdiplus restores functionality. It seems the calls to cairo/pango are not returning data. Thus it seems all font rendering that isn't of system-wide fonts will fail. This is bad. Who is responsible for this package now that mono has given it to winehq?
